A train trip from Heswall to Milton Keynes Central takes about 3hrs 21 mins on average, covering roughly 131 miles (211 kilometres). With around 17 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£21.30,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Nestled on the Wirral Peninsula, Heswall train station serves as a charming portal to a variety of destinations across the region. Whether you're a local resident seeking a quick commute or a visitor eager to explore the north-west of England, you'll find Heswall Station a convenient starting point. Though equipped with only basic amenities, this station's strategic location connects you effortlessly with key locations in the area.
While Heswall Station may not boast an array of services, it does offer essentials for travelers. You'll find step-free access to platforms, making it a viable option for those with mobility issues. However, be aware that there is no ticket office or machines for purchasing or collecting tickets onsite. The absence of a waiting room or toilets may encourage travelers to plan ahead before arriving at the station. Fortunately, seating is available should you require a moment to rest before your journey.
Despite its limited facilities, Heswall station is well-supported by local transport links. The nearest bus stops are conveniently situated just outside the station car park, enhancing your options for onward journeys. While there's no provision for bicycle storage or hire, the ease of connectivity with local buses can effectively bridge the gap for eco-conscious travelers choosing public transport.

Perched amidst the bustling city, Milton Keynes Central stands as a gateway to the rest of the UK. Whether you're a daily commuter or a curious traveler, this station promises convenience coupled with a dash of adventure. With a wide range of connections to major cities and local towns, Milton Keynes Central is a hub of activity for all who pass through its turnstiles.
Milton Keynes Central is fully equipped to cater to the needs of every traveler. The ticket office is open from early morning until late at night, ensuring that you can secure your passage at a time that suits you. For those who prefer digital options, ticket machines are readily available, and they're designed with accessibility in mind. You'll find that the station offers a wide range of amenities, including refreshment facilities such as a coffee shop, coffee kiosk, and food vending machines, alongside ATMs and a convenience store.
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access throughout the station and a host of facilities for those requiring additional assistance. If you're cycling to the station, you'll be pleased to know there's ample bicycle storage, including stands and sheltered spaces under CCTV surveillance. Bike hire is also available from Santander Cycles, just outside the station—perfect for those looking to explore the city on two wheels.
For travelers looking to keep connected, there's a pay phone available, though you may need to rely on mobile data as public Wi-Fi is not provided. In terms of security and peace of mind, the station is accredited by the Secure Station Scheme and is monitored by CCTV.
Milton Keynes Central is not just about trains—there are several ways to continue your journey across the city or to more distant destinations. Taxis are conveniently stationed right outside the main entrance, making it easy to hail a cab for your onward travel. A range of bus services also operates from the station, and information for planning your journey is readily available. If traveling by train isn't an option due to service disruptions, rail replacement vehicles are organized from specific bus stops, adding convenience in times of need.
For those interested in renting a car for the day or longer, a number of national and local car hire services can be found in the vicinity of the station, making it easy to continue your travels.
